This one's a bit of a mixed bag; some love its unique aromatic iris, others find it too reminiscent of church or soap. Give it time to macerate, then decide if its powdery floral charms are for you.
A reliable all-rounder that's less of a statement, more of a solid, pleasing background hum. It's a versatile choice that won't offend, making it a safe bet for nearly any situation where you want to smell good without shouting about it.
